EU Divides Over Israel Sanctions Amid Gaza War, Germany Blocks Measures
The European Union remains deeply divided over how to respond to the humanitarian crisis in Gaza and potential punitive measures against Israel, with no consensus reached at a recent informal meeting of EU foreign ministers in Copenhagen. European Commission Vice-President Kaja Kallas expressed disappointment over the lack of unity, highlighting disagreements on suspending free trade with Israel under the EU-Israel Association Agreement, with countries like Germany and Hungary opposing the move. Dutch Foreign Minister Ruben Brekelmans noted the polarization within the bloc but mentioned the possibility of a smaller group of countries forming a core coalition to take action, including suspending trade and increasing sanctions against Israeli officials. Germany, represented by Foreign Minister Johan Wadephul, has blocked sanctions such as suspending research funding for Israeli companies, arguing that such measures would be ineffective, instead focusing on restricting arms deliveries to Israel. Despite proposals to impose tariffs on imports from occupied territories and exclude Israel from research programs like Horizon, the EU faces challenges in achieving a qualified majority for sanctions due to differing national stances. Overall, EU officials acknowledge that any measures adopted may have limited impact, but some see limited contributions as better than inaction.
